示例1: loadSchema

import com.sun.org.apache.xerces.internal.utils.SecuritySupport; //导入方法依赖的package包/类
/**
 * This method is called either from XMLGrammarLoader.loadGrammar or from XMLSchemaValidator.
 * Note: in either case, the EntityManager (or EntityResolvers) are not going to be invoked
 * to resolve the location of the schema in XSDDescription
 * @param desc
 * @param source
 * @param locationPairs
 * @return An XML Schema grammar
 * @throws IOException
 * @throws XNIException
 */
SchemaGrammar loadSchema(XSDDescription desc,
        XMLInputSource source,
        Map locationPairs) throws IOException, XNIException {

    // this should only be done once per invocation of this object;
    // unless application alters JAXPSource in the mean time.
    if(!fJAXPProcessed) {
        processJAXPSchemaSource(locationPairs);
    }

    if (desc.isExternal()) {
        String accessError = SecuritySupport.checkAccess(desc.getExpandedSystemId(), faccessExternalSchema, Constants.ACCESS_EXTERNAL_ALL);
        if (accessError != null) {
            throw new XNIException(fErrorReporter.reportError(XSMessageFormatter.SCHEMA_DOMAIN,
                    "schema_reference.access",
                    new Object[] { SecuritySupport.sanitizePath(desc.getExpandedSystemId()), accessError }, XMLErrorReporter.SEVERITY_ERROR));
        }
    }
    SchemaGrammar grammar = fSchemaHandler.parseSchema(source, desc, locationPairs);

    return grammar;
}

示例4: getSchemaDocument

import com.sun.org.apache.xerces.internal.utils.SecuritySupport; //导入方法依赖的package包/类
/**
 * getSchemaDocument method uses XMLInputSource to parse a schema document.
 * @param schemaNamespace
 * @param schemaSource
 * @param mustResolve
 * @param referType
 * @param referElement
 * @return A schema Element.
 */
private Element getSchemaDocument(String schemaNamespace, XMLInputSource schemaSource,
        boolean mustResolve, short referType, Element referElement) {

    boolean hasInput = true;
    IOException exception = null;
    // contents of this method will depend on the system we adopt for entity resolution--i.e., XMLEntityHandler, EntityHandler, etc.
    Element schemaElement = null;
    try {
        // when the system id and byte stream and character stream
        // of the input source are all null, it's
        // impossible to find the schema document. so we skip in
        // this case. otherwise we'll receive some NPE or
        // file not found errors. but schemaHint=="" is perfectly
        // legal for import.
        if (schemaSource != null &&
                (schemaSource.getSystemId() != null ||
                        schemaSource.getByteStream() != null ||
                        schemaSource.getCharacterStream() != null)) {

            // When the system id of the input source is used, first try to
            // expand it, and check whether the same document has been
            // parsed before. If so, return the document corresponding to
            // that system id.
            XSDKey key = null;
            String schemaId = null;
            if (referType != XSDDescription.CONTEXT_PREPARSE){
                schemaId = XMLEntityManager.expandSystemId(schemaSource.getSystemId(), schemaSource.getBaseSystemId(), false);
                key = new XSDKey(schemaId, referType, schemaNamespace);
                if((schemaElement = (Element)fTraversed.get(key)) != null) {
                    fLastSchemaWasDuplicate = true;
                    return schemaElement;
                }
                if (referType == XSDDescription.CONTEXT_IMPORT || referType == XSDDescription.CONTEXT_INCLUDE
                        || referType == XSDDescription.CONTEXT_REDEFINE) {
                    String accessError = SecuritySupport.checkAccess(schemaId, fAccessExternalSchema, Constants.ACCESS_EXTERNAL_ALL);
                    if (accessError != null) {
                        reportSchemaFatalError("schema_reference.access",
                                new Object[] { SecuritySupport.sanitizePath(schemaId), accessError },
                                referElement);
                    }
                }
            }

            fSchemaParser.parse(schemaSource);
            Document schemaDocument = fSchemaParser.getDocument();
            schemaElement = schemaDocument != null ? DOMUtil.getRoot(schemaDocument) : null;
            return getSchemaDocument0(key, schemaId, schemaElement);
        }
        else {
            hasInput = false;
        }
    }
    catch (IOException ex) {
        exception = ex;
    }
    return getSchemaDocument1(mustResolve, hasInput, schemaSource, referElement, exception);
}

示例7: checkAccess

import com.sun.org.apache.xerces.internal.utils.SecuritySupport; //导入方法依赖的package包/类
/**
 * Check the protocol used in the systemId against allowed protocols
 *
 * @param systemId the Id of the URI
 * @param allowedProtocols a list of allowed protocols separated by comma
 * @return the name of the protocol if rejected, null otherwise
 */
String checkAccess(String systemId, String allowedProtocols) throws IOException {
    String baseSystemId = fEntityScanner.getBaseSystemId();
    String expandedSystemId = fEntityManager.expandSystemId(systemId, baseSystemId,fStrictURI);
    return SecuritySupport.checkAccess(expandedSystemId, allowedProtocols, Constants.ACCESS_EXTERNAL_ALL);
}
